ForeignExchangeTrading

Withoutforeignexchangetrading,internationaltradeitselfcouldnotexist.Informertimestradewasbasedonbartering—goodswereexchangedforothergoods.Theintroductionofpreciousmetals(i.e.,goldandsilver)topayforgoodscanbeconsideredtheforerunneroftheforeignexchangemarket.TheGreeksandRomanscommonlyusedgoldasamediumofexchange.Mostworldtradecontinuedtobebasedongolduntilthenineteenthcentury.ButthenindustrializationinWesternEuropeandtheUnitedStateshadboostedworldtradetosuchanextentthatgoldreserverwerenolongeradequatetomeettherequirements.Governmentsintroducedaparvalueoftheirrespectivelocalcurrenciesingold.Thus,thecurrencieswererelatedtooneanotherthroughasystemcalledthegoldstandard.Thegoldstandardsystemdeterminedthevalueofallcurrenciesbasedongold.

(1)ThesystemworkedwelluntilWorldWarI,whentradewasinterrupted.Afterthewar,currenciesfluctuatedwidelyintermsofgoldand,thus,inrelationtoeachother.Thevalueofcurrencieswasmeanttoberegulatedbysupplyanddemand(themarketmechanism),butspeculatorsofteninterferedwiththismechanism.Soinanefforttocreatemorestableexchangemarkets,somecountries,notablytheUnitedStates,England,andFrance,returnedtothegoldstandard.

(2)By1971itwastheonlycountrywhosecurrencyremainedconvertibleintogold,andse,bydeclaringthedollarinconvertible,thegoldstandardwasfinallyabolished.

In1944towardtheendofWorldWarⅡ,theWesternindustrializednationsrealizedthatforeigntradewouldbenecessarytoquicklyandeffectivelyhealthewoundsofwar.Tocreateacalmandstableforeignexchangemarket,theUnitedStatesgovernmentcalledforaconferenceinthesummerof1944.ItwasheldinBrettonWoods,NewHampshire.(3)

TheBrettonWoodsAgreementstipulatedthatallmembercountrieswouldexpressthevalueoftheircurrenciesingold.However,onlytheUnitedStatesdollarwasconvertibleintogold,atthepriceof$35anounce.

Centralbanksofthemembercountrieswererequiredtointerveneintheforeignexchangemarketstokeepthevalueoftheircurrencieswithin1percentoftheparvalue.Thisinterventionwasachievedbybuyingorsellingforeignexchangeorgold.Agivencurrencycould,therefore,neverriseabovenorfallbelowfixedpoints,whicharecalledinterventionpoints.Thesearethepricesbeyondwhichthecentralbankintervenes.(4)

Thesystemoffixedearly1970s.Atthattimeanumberofcountriesdevaluedtheircurrencies.Thismeantthattheircurrencieswerenowworthlessintermsofgold.Englandin1967,Francein1969,andtheUnitedStatesin1971and1973,devaluedtheircurrencies,Thiscausedanalmostunprecedentedturbulenceintheforeignexchangemarkets.Inaddition,countriessuchasWestGermanyandHollandrevaluedtheircurrencies(increasedtheparvalueoftheircurrenciesintermsofgold).Interventionbycentralbanksbecameverycostly.Foreigncurrencyandgoldreservesweredrained.(5)

DepartmentStoreMagic

Formostofthe20thcenturySmithson'swasoneofBritain'smostsuccessfuldepartmentstores,butbythemid-1990s,ithadbecomedull.Stillprofitable,thankslargelytoaseriesofsuccessfuladvertisingcampaigns,butdecidedlyboring.Thefamouswerecarefulnottobeseenthere,anditssalesstaffdidn'tseemtohavechangedsincethestoreopenedin1908.Worstofall,itscustomerswerebuyingfewerandfewerofitsownbrandproducts,themajorpartofitsbusiness,andshowingapreferenceformorefashionablebrands.

Butnowallthehaschanged,thankstoRowenaBaker,whobecameSmithson'sfirstwomanChiefExecutivethreeyearsago.Sincethen,whilemostmajorretailersinBritainhavebeenlosingmoney,Smithson'sprofitshavebeenrisingsteadily.WhenBakerstarted,alotofimprovementshadjustbeenmaketothebuilding,withouthavinganyeffectonsales,andshetookthebolddecisiontoinviteoneofEurope'smostexcitinginteriordesignerstodevelopthefashionarea,theheartofthestore.Thisveryquicklyledtorisingsales,evenbeforethegoodsondisplaywerechanged.Andassalesgrew,sodidprofits.

Bakerhadambitiousplansforthestorefromthestart,'We'replayingabiggame,toprovewe'reuptherewiththeleadersinoursector,andwehavetomakesurepeoplegetthatmessage.Smithson'shadfallenbehindthecompetition.Itprovideatraditionalservicetargetedatmiddle-aged,middle-incomecustomers,who'dbeenshoppingthereforyears,andthecustomerbasewasgraduallycontracting.Ourideaistosellsuchanexcitingvarietyofgoodsthateveryonewillwanttocomein,whethertheyplantospendalittleoralot.'Baker'svisionforthestoreisclear,butachievingitisfarfromsimple.Atfirst,manyemployeesresistedherimprovementsbecausetheyjustwouldn'tbepersuadedthattherewasanythingwrongwiththewaythey'dalwaysdonethings,eveniftheyacceptedthatthestorehadtoovertakeitscompetitors.Ittookmanylongmeetings,involvingtheentireworkforce,towintheirsupport.IthelpedwhentheyrealisedthatBakerwasaverydifferentkindofmanagerfromtheonestheyhadknown.

Baker'sstaffpoliciescontainedmoresurprises.Theuniformthathadhardlychangedsincedayonehasnowdisappeared.Moreover,teenagersnowgetyoungshopassistants,andstaffinthesportsdepartmentsarethemselvessportsfansintrainers.AsBakerexplains,'Howcanyouseejeansifyou'rewearingablacksuit?

Smithson'shasanewidentity,andthisneedstobemadecleartothecustomers.'She'salsogiveneverysalesassistantresponsibilityforensuringcustomersatisfaction,evenifitmeansoccasionallybreakingcompanyrulesinthehopecompanyprofits.
